JCR/Honda’s Colton Udall WINS back to back to back on the weekend and WINS a 2011 D37 AMA Big 6 Championship

November 8th, 2011

JCR LogoThis past weekend Gorman played host to the final round of the highly contested 2011 D37 AMA Big 6 GP series. The course was a mix of high speed 2 track, canyon single track and motocross terrain. Colton Udall and Timmy Weigand were on hand to race the open, 4 stroke and team race.
Timmy Weigand raced a Honda CRF450R and Colton Udall raced the JCR/Honda modified Honda CRF450X. Read the rest of this entry »

Norman races to victory at the 100’s MC AMA National Hare & Hound

October 27th, 2011

JCR LogoThis past weekend Lucerne Valley played host to the final round of the 2011 AMA National Hare and Hound series. Kendall Norman’s performance was a near duplicate of his previous race just 2 weeks before where he took his Honda CRF450X to yet another wire to wire victory. Read the rest of this entry »

FAR Husqvarna On The Podium at Ironman GNCC

October 27th, 2011

Husqvarna Blue LogoAndrew Delong finishes third in XC2 Pro Lites at his first race with FAR Husqvarna

October 24, 2011 – Corona, CA – At the Ironman GNCC in Crawfordsville, Indiana, the newest member of the Fred Andrews Racing (FAR) Husqvarna team – Andrew Delong – recorded a podium finish in the XC2 class. Meanwhile, Jason Thomas continued to forge ahead, this time racing to a sixth-place finish despite a broken hand! Read the rest of this entry »

2012 AMA ATV Motocross Series National Schedule Announced

October 20th, 2011

ATVMX Logo2012 AMA ATV Motocross Series National Schedule Announced

Morgantown, W.Va. (October 17, 2011) – MX Sports Pro Racing and ATVPG announce today the 2012 schedule for America’s most prestigious and longest standing ATV racing series – the AMA ATV Motocross National Championship Series presented by DWT. The 2012 ten race series kicks off March 24 and 25 at Millcreek Raceway in Pell City, Ala. and wraps up August 11 and 12 at Loretta Lynn Ranch in Hurricane Mills, Tenn. Read the rest of this entry »
